Understanding the Materials
Before we compare them, we must define what these materials actually are.
What is Vinyl Siding?
Introduced in the 1950s as a replacement for aluminum siding, vinyl siding is primarily made of polyvinyl chloride (PVC) plastic. It is manufactured by extruding the plastic through a mold, creating a solid panel where the color is baked completely through the material. Because the color goes all the way through, scratches do not reveal a different base color.
- The Evolution: Early vinyl looked cheap and plastic-y. Today, manufacturers offer "premium insulated vinyl" which features a thick foam backing that makes the panel rigid (preventing it from rattling in the wind) and heavily increases the home's R-value (energy efficiency).
What is Fiber Cement Siding?
Pioneered by James Hardie in the 1980s, fiber cement is a composite material made from a mixture of Portland cement, sand, water, and cellulose (wood) fibers. This slurry is pressed into massive molds and baked in an autoclave under high pressure.
- The Result: The resulting boards are incredibly heavy, completely rigid, and feel very similar to real masonry or stone. They must be painted or ordered with a factory-applied baked-on paint finish (like James Hardie's ColorPlus® Technology).
1. Aesthetic Capabilities and Curb Appeal
If your primary goal is maximizing the architectural beauty of your home, this is where the two materials diverge significantly.
The Look of Real Wood
Fiber cement is the undisputed winner when it comes to mimicking the texture of real wood. Because it is pressed into molds cast from actual cedar boards, it features deep, authentic, non-repeating wood grain patterns. When painted, it is almost indistinguishable from real wood from just a few feet away.
Vinyl siding is stamped with a faux wood grain, but because it is thin plastic, the grain is shallow. In direct sunlight, standard vinyl often gives off a slight synthetic sheen or glare that betrays its plastic composition.
Architectural Profiles and Shadows
Because fiber cement is thick (often 5/16 of an inch), it casts deep, crisp, dramatic shadow lines along the lap of the boards. This is critical for historic renovations or high-end modern designs where bold shadow lines are desired.
Standard vinyl is thin. To create rigidity, it is molded with overlapping curves. This means it doesn't sit perfectly flat against the wall, resulting in softer, less dramatic shadow lines.
Seams and Overlaps
When vinyl siding is installed, the panels overlap each other by about an inch. Because it expands and contracts heavily with temperature changes, it cannot be caulked. This means the vertical seams where two boards meet are highly visible.
Fiber cement expands and contracts very little. The boards are butted directly against each other, flashed, and can be cleanly caulked. This creates a much more seamless, premium look.
2. Durability and Extreme Weather Resistance

Rot, Pests, and Moisture
Both materials are exceptional at resisting rot and insects. Termites and carpenter ants have zero interest in eating plastic (vinyl) or concrete (fiber cement). Both are massive upgrades over real wood in damp climates.
Impact Resistance (Hail and Baseballs)
- Vinyl: Standard vinyl becomes brittle in freezing temperatures. If a large hailstone or a stray baseball hits cold vinyl, it will shatter or crack, leaving a permanent hole that requires replacing the entire panel.
- Fiber Cement: Because it is essentially flexible concrete, fiber cement is incredibly impact-resistant. It easily shrugs off hail, stray golf balls, and aggressive weed-whacking without denting or cracking.
Fire Resistance
- Vinyl: PVC plastic is highly combustible. In a house fire, or if a barbecue grill is placed too close to the wall, vinyl siding will rapidly melt, warp, and eventually catch fire, releasing toxic fumes.
- Fiber Cement: Fiber cement is completely non-combustible. It is rated as a Class A fire-resistant material. It will not melt or burn, making it the mandated choice in many wildfire-prone regions (like California and Colorado).
3. Maintenance Requirements
No siding is truly "zero maintenance," but they require very different types of upkeep.
Vinyl: The "Wash and Go" Siding
Vinyl is famous for being low maintenance. Because the color is baked entirely through the plastic, it technically never needs to be painted. Your only required maintenance is an annual soft-wash (using a hose and mild detergent) to remove dirt and algae.
- The Catch: Over 15 to 20 years, the sun's UV rays will slowly fade the color. Because the color is in the plastic, it is very difficult to successfully paint old vinyl siding, as the dark paint absorbs heat and causes the plastic to warp.
Fiber Cement: The Painted Finish
Fiber cement acts like real wood in that it must be painted to protect it from moisture. If you buy primed boards, you must pay a painter to paint the house after installation, and you will need to repaint it every 7 to 10 years.
- The Solution: Most homeowners opt for factory-painted fiber cement (like James Hardie ColorPlus). The paint is baked on in a controlled environment, resulting in a finish that is guaranteed not to peel, crack, or fade significantly for 15 years.
4. The Cost Comparison: Budget vs. Premium Investment
The biggest deciding factor for most homeowners is the price.
Material and Labor Costs
- Vinyl Siding: Is cheap to manufacture, lightweight, and very easy to cut (contractors use basic snips). A two-man crew can side a house in vinyl very rapidly.
- Fully Installed Cost: $7.00 to $12.00 per square foot.
- Fiber Cement: Is expensive to manufacture, incredibly heavy (a single 12-foot board weighs over 20 lbs), and creates hazardous silica dust when cut. It requires specialized diamond-tipped saw blades, respiratory masks, and often a larger crew to carry and nail the heavy boards safely.
- Fully Installed Cost: $11.00 to $18.00 per square foot.
Return on Investment (ROI)
If you plan to sell your home in the next 5 years, fiber cement offers a vastly superior ROI. Real estate agents frequently highlight "Hardie Board" in home listings because buyers recognize it as a premium, luxury upgrade. According to national data, fiber cement consistently recoups 75% to 85% of its cost at resale, while vinyl recoups closer to 60%.
Frequently Asked Questions (FAQ)
Q: Can I install fiber cement myself (DIY)?
A: I highly discourage this. Fiber cement is brittle before it is nailed to the wall; carrying it improperly will snap the boards in half. Furthermore, cutting it requires specialized dust-collection saws. Leave fiber cement to specialized, certified contractors.
Q: Is insulated vinyl worth the extra money?
A: Yes. Upgrading from standard hollow vinyl to insulated vinyl (which has a foam backing contoured to the board) drastically increases the rigidity of the panel, improves impact resistance, and makes the wall feel much more solid to the touch.
Q: How long does fiber cement last?
A: When properly installed and maintained (caulked and painted), fiber cement siding can easily last 50 years. Most premium manufacturers offer 30-year, non-prorated warranties on the boards themselves.
My Final Verdict
Choosing between vinyl and fiber cement comes down to your budget and how long you plan to stay in the home.
If you are on a strict budget, flipping a starter home, or own a rental property, Premium Insulated Vinyl is an excellent, low-maintenance choice that will protect the home for decades.
However, if this is your forever home, if you live in an area prone to severe weather (hail, wildfires, hurricanes), or if you demand the absolute highest level of architectural curb appeal and authentic wood textures, Fiber Cement is undeniably the superior investment.
